Halil Eyyuboglu

1953-2023

His family shared the message below with us.

It is with deep sadness that we announce the passing of Prof. Dr. Halil Tanyer Eyyuboğlu, an esteemed academic and proud alumnus of Loughborough University. Prof. Eyyuboğlu obtained his Ph.D. in Electronics and Communication Engineering from Loughborough University of Technology in 1982, laying the foundation for a distinguished career in electrical and electronics engineering.

Throughout his career, Prof. Eyyuboğlu made significant contributions to the fields of telecommunications, optics, and photonics. His research on the propagation properties of optical beams in turbulent atmospheres was widely recognised, and he published numerous influential papers in esteemed scientific journals. His outstanding contributions to science were further acknowledged in 2022 when he was named among the world's top 2% most influential scientists by Stanford University (Stanford List).

He held various academic positions, including serving as the Head of the Electrical and Electronics Engineering Department at Çankırı Karatekin University from 2018 to 2023, before joining Ankara Bilim University in a similar role. His dedication to teaching and research left an indelible mark on his students and colleagues alike.

Beyond academia, Prof. Eyyuboğlu had a deep appreciation for nature and photography, often capturing stunning images of wildlife in his garden in Ankara. He was known not only for his intellectual rigor but also for his kindness, mentorship, and unwavering support for his students and peers.

His passing on 10 September 2023 is a great loss to the academic community and to those who had the privilege of knowing him. His legacy will continue to inspire future generations of engineers and researchers.
